Output 51dbc923f0ea557537d9ca230774baaf585a748df4141fd9b96e9cad15edeb24:6

value
1031413525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5e5d4bd35698665435cecfcd0eace7d0b905b6 OP_EQUAL
address
MPcZVyrnkAx8J2HGbGmZzKVrgTkiWSZfXY
transaction
51dbc923f0ea557537d9ca230774baaf585a748df4141fd9b96e9cad15edeb24
spent
true